DTC B1825/56 Short in Front Passenger Side - Side Squib Circuit

DTC B1826/56 Open in Front Passenger Side - Side Squib Circuit

DTC B1827/56 Short to GND in Front Passenger Side - Side Squib Circuit

DTC B1828/56 Short to B+ in Front Passenger Side - Side Squib Circuit


DESCRIPTION

The front passenger side - side squib circuit consists of the center airbag sensor and the front passenger side - side airbag.
The circuit instructs the SRS to deploy when the deployment conditions are met.
These DTCs are recorded when a malfunction is detected in the front passenger side - side squib circuit.

DTC Code
Detection Condition
Trouble Area
B1825/56
When all conditions below are met:
  1. The center airbag sensor receives a line short circuit signal 5 times in the front passenger side - side squib circuit during primary check.
  2. Front passenger side - side squib malfunction
  3. Center airbag sensor malfunction
  1. Floor wire
  2. Front seat side airbag assembly LH
  3. Center airbag sensor assembly
B1826/56
When all conditions below are met:
  1. The center airbag sensor receives an open circuit signal in the front passenger side - side squib circuit for 2 seconds.
  2. Front passenger side - side squib malfunction
  3. Center airbag sensor malfunction
  1. Floor wire
  2. Front seat side airbag assembly LH
  3. Center airbag sensor assembly
B1827/56
When all conditions below are met:
  1. The center airbag sensor receives a short circuit to ground signal in the front passenger side - side squib circuit for 0.5 seconds.
  2. Front passenger side - side squib malfunction
  3. Center airbag sensor malfunction
  1. Floor wire
  2. Front seat side airbag assembly LH
  3. Center airbag sensor assembly
B1828/56
When all conditions below are met:
  1. The center airbag sensor receives a short circuit to B+ signal in the front passenger side - side squib circuit for 0.5 seconds.
  2. Front passenger side - side squib malfunction
  3. Center airbag sensor malfunction
  1. Floor wire
  2. Front seat side airbag assembly LH
  3. Center airbag sensor assembly

INSPECTION PROCEDURE

1.CHECK FRONT SEAT SIDE AIRBAG LH (SIDE SQUIB LH)

  1. Turn the ignition switch OFF.

  1. Disconnect the negative (-) terminal cable from the battery, and wait for at least 90 seconds.

  1. Disconnect the connector from the front seat side airbag LH.

  1. Connect the red wire side of SST (resistance: 2.1 Ω) to connector C.

    CAUTION:
    Never connect the tester to the front seat side airbag LH (side squib LH) for measurement, as this may lead to a serious injury due to airbag deployment.
    NOTICE:
    1. Do not forcibly insert SST into the terminals of the connector when connecting SST.
    2. Insert SST straight into the terminals of the connector.
SST
09843-18061
  1. Connect the negative (-) terminal cable to the battery, and wait for at least 2 seconds.

  1. Turn the ignition switch ON, and wait for at least 60 seconds.

  1. Clear the DTCs (Toyota Fortuner RM000000YVY008X.html).

  1. Turn the ignition switch OFF.

  1. Turn the ignition switch ON, and wait for at least 60 seconds.

  1. Check for DTCs (Toyota Fortuner RM000000YVY008X.html).

    OK:
    DTC B1825, B1826, B1827 or B1828 is not output
    HINT:
    Codes other than DTC B1825, B1826, B1827, B1828 may be output at this time, but they are not related to this check.


NG
Go to step 2
OK

REPLACE FRONT SEATBACK ASSEMBLY LH

2.CHECK FLOOR WIRE (SIDE SQUIB LH CIRCUIT)

  1. Turn the ignition switch OFF.

  1. Disconnect the negative (-) terminal cable from the battery, and wait for at least 90 seconds.

  1. Disconnect SST from connector C.

  1. Disconnect the connectors from the center airbag sensor.

  1. Connect the negative (-) terminal cable to the battery, and wait for at least 2 seconds.

  1. Turn the ignition switch ON.

  1. Measure the voltage according to the value(s) in the table below.

    Standard Voltage:
    Tester Connection
    Switch Condition
    Specified Condition
    S28-1 (SFL+) - Body ground
    Ignition switch ON
    Below 1 V
    S28-2 (SFL-) - Body ground
  1. Turn the ignition switch OFF.

  1. Disconnect the negative (-) terminal cable from the battery, and wait for at least 90 seconds.

  1.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the table below.

    Standard Resistance:
    Tester Connection
    Condition
    Specified Condition
    S28-1 (SFL+) - S28-2 (SFL-)
    Always
    Below 1 Ω
  1. Release the activation prevention mechanism built into connector B (Toyota Fortuner RM000000XFD0EGX.html).

  1.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the table below.

    Standard Resistance:
    Tester Connection
    Condition
    Specified Condition
    S28-1 (SFL+) - S28-2 (SFL-)
    Always
    1 MΩ or higher
    S28-1 (SFL+) - Body ground
    S28-2 (SFL-) - Body ground


NG
REPLACE FLOOR WIRE
OK


3.CHECK CENTER AIRBAG SENSOR ASSEMBLY

  1. Connect the connectors to the front seat side airbag LH and the center airbag sensor.

  1. Connect the negative (-) terminal cable to the battery, and wait for at least 2 seconds.

  1. Turn the ignition switch ON, and wait for at least 60 seconds.

  1. Clear the DTCs (Toyota Fortuner RM000000YVY008X.html).

  1. Turn the ignition switch OFF.

  1. Turn the ignition switch ON, and wait for at least 60 seconds.

  1. Check for DTCs (Toyota Fortuner RM000000YVY008X.html).

    OK:
    DTC B1825, B1826, B1827 or B1828 is not output
    HINT:
    Codes other than DTC B1825, B1826, B1827, B1828 may be output at this time, but they are not related to this check.


NG
REPLACE CENTER AIRBAG SENSOR ASSEMBLY
OK

USE SIMULATION METHOD TO CHECK
